This course takes you through the chess journey of six extraordinary players who left their mark through attack, creativity, and tactical brilliance.
Grandmasters Andrés Rodríguez and Diego Flores analyze iconic games by Paul Morphy, Wilhelm Steinitz, Mikhail Tal, Bobby Fischer, Garry Kasparov, and Alexey Shirov, breaking down the ideas behind some of their most memorable combinations.
Through these examples, you will learn how to build an attack, spot tactical opportunities, coordinate your pieces, and develop a sharper instinct for sacrifices and forcing sequences.

GM Andrés Rodríguez Vila is the first and only Grandmaster in the history of Uruguayan chess. He started playing at age 10, played his first World Youth Championship at 12, and became his country's first International Master at 18. Recognized as one of the most creative players in South America, he qualified for the 2009 World Cup and represented Uruguay in multiple Olympiads. Today he combines high-level competition with outstanding work as a coach.

GM Diego Flores is a leading figure in contemporary Argentine chess. He earned his Grand Master title in 2008 and reached a peak FIDE rating of 2634. A multi-time Argentine champion —matching Miguel Najdorf's historic record of titles—, he has represented his country in seven Chess Olympiads and won the 2018 Dubai Open. He combines a deep chess culture with a great ability to clearly explain complex ideas.
